CI authenticates to AWS with GitHub OIDC, not a static access key, so there are no AWS_ACCESS_KEY_ID / AWS_SECRET_ACCESS_KEY secrets to set. The role each environment assumes is configured per-environment below (AWS_DEPLOY_ROLE_ARN).
The remaining configuration is set per-environment under Settings -> Environments -> [environment name]. Create two environments per named branch: prod (maps to main), gate-prod, stage, gate-stage, development, and gate-development. Optionally add protection rules to the three gate-* environments. Potentially destructive jobs in Github workflows are placed behind other jobs that depend on the gate-* environments, making them the best place for protection rules. Required reviewers on the gate environments are also what pause the first provisioning run between the dns and infra stages (see setup), so add them at least for that run.
CI assumes an IAM role via GitHub OIDC instead of using static keys. Set this as a variable (not a secret) on each of prod, stage, and development, pointing at the cicd role in that environment’s AWS account.

The Claude automation workflow (.github/workflows/claude.yml) runs the
Claude Code Action with an explicit --allowed-tools allowlist and
--permission-mode acceptEdits, not bypassPermissions. File edits apply
automatically (there is no human in CI to approve them), but every shell
command is checked against the allowlist and anything outside it fails
closed. Because the prompt embeds untrusted issue and comment text, the
allowlist is a security boundary, not just a convenience: destructive shell
verbs such as rm are deliberately absent so a prompt-injection payload
cannot run them even if it slips past the untrusted-input wrapper.
Both jobs – on-labeled-issue and on-mention – carry the same list, and
the Dependabot remediation job (.github/workflows/dependabot.yml) carries
its own narrower one.
When a legitimate Claude run needs a tool that is not on the list, the
command is denied and the denial is visible in the run log (the on-mention
job sets show_full_output: true, and the labeled-issue job surfaces it in
the transcript). To grant it:
